I need some advice on how to get rid of my Debelius' Reef Lobster because he has killed 2 peppermint shrimp, 1 scarlet skunk cleaner shrimp, a blood red fire shrimp, and a yellowhead jawfish. So if anyone has any suggestions on how to remove him or tame him please reply.
 
build a trap for it. I think the easiest approach is to bury a Gatorade bottle to your sand bed so the opening is at sand surface level. Tie a fishing line to the mouth of the bottle first. Bait the trap with some table shrimp chunks and yank out the bottle when the lobster goes in.
